if self.metaconfig_id:
if not force_append:
if self.metaconfig_params_only:
return
if (
consider_metaconfig
and self.metaconfig
and "ch.ehi.ili2db" in self.metaconfig.sections()
):
metaconfig_ili2db_params = self.metaconfig["ch.ehi.ili2db"]
if values[0][2:] in metaconfig_ili2db_params.keys():
# if the value is set in the metaconfig, then we do consider it instead
return
args += values
